One day, Debbie's doorbell rang suddenly. It was 16-year-old Amy from next door. "Help! My brother Dylan is bleeding," she shouted. Debbie and her sister Ellen ran to their house to find 8-year-old Dylan bleeding heavily from a huge cut on his arm. Amy was looking after Dylan while their mom was shopping. But Dylan fell down while running through the house, pushing his arm through a glass door panel(镶板) by accident.
Debbie took a first-aid course and knew what to do. "I need to apply pressure to the cut to stop the bleeding. I got a towel(毛巾) from the bathroom and will use it to press on the wound (伤口),"she said. Dylan was crying so Debbie comforted(安慰) him while she was pressing on the towel to stop the blood from running. She told Ellen to call an ambulance(救护车). Amy was so upset to see Dylan's blood that she had to go and wait in another room. Just as the ambulance came,Dylan's mother got back. She was deeply shocked but held Dylan's arm at once. Then the two of them travelled to the hospital together in the ambulance.
A few weeks later, Dylan got well and was back from the hospital.
Dylan's mother thanked Debbie and Ellen. "I'm so happy that I have learned first aid, "Debbie said. "The towel did a great job of stopping the blood from running.

Do you know mountains that look like huge stone pillars(石柱)? Many people feel surprised when they first see the special mountains in Zhangjiajie. How did these mountains form Let's travel through time to discover their story.
Long ago, Zhangjiajie was under water. Rivers brought sand to the seabed.Year after year, new sand fell on the old sand. The sand layers(层) grew thicker(厚的) and thicker like a giant cake in the oven, with each new layer pressing the old ones tighter. The heavy new sand pushed the old sand together. After millions of years, the sand became hard rock. The hard rock was sandstone.
Then, something amazing happened. The seabed slowly ascended and became dry land. The sandstone started breaking into big pieces.
Now came nature's artists-wind and water. Strong winds blew against the sandstone, while rainwater made small holes (洞) in the stones. Like a knife cutting cakes, rivers ran through these holes and made them deeper. These two natural artists slowly changed the sandstone into beautiful stone pillars.
But this story isn't over. Even now, wind and rain keep making the stone pillars smaller. Every year, these pillars lose a tiny bit of their height. And then new cracks(裂缝) appear. Scientists say that after millions more years, these stone pillars will completely disappear. So we're ▲ to see this natural wonder before it's all gone.

When it comes to the Himalayas(喜马拉雅山脉), what do you have in your mind High mountains White snow Both answers are right, but in the mountains, there is a place called the Valley of Flowers and you can see a very different situation there. It is home to pretty flowers, wild plants and endangered (濒危的) animals.
The Valley of Flowers is in Uttarakhand, one state in the north of India. It is more than 87.5square kilometres. There are flowers everywhere. However, these flowers are not quite the same as what we often see. They grow in high places in the mountains. There are hundreds of different kinds of flowers in this valley. They bloom(开花) between June and September. When the flowers bloom,the valley looks like a magical world with different colours.
There are also a lot of wild plants, such as trees and grass, in the Valley of Flowers. They are special. Some of them are hard to find anywhere else in the world! What's more, some endangered animals live in the valley, like snow leopards.
Now people have turned the Valley of Flowers into a national park. Visitors can't build anything or live there. They can't even stay there for too long at a time. They can only stay there for one day.
It's probably not long enough for visitors to see all the real beauty there.
